Building Healthy Neighborhoods: Working Together to Achieve Health Equity in The Bronx
Program Schedule (Draft)
July 10, 2009
8:00am - 9:00am Continental Breakfast and Registration
9:00am – 9:30am Welcome and Opening Remarks
Hal Strelnick, MD*
Director
Institute for Community & Collaborative Health (ICCH)
Bronx Center to Reduce and Eliminate Ethnic and Racial
Health Disparities (BxCREED)
Albert Einstein College of Medicine
Gladys Valdivieso*
Director, Community Health Outreach
Montefiore Medical Center
9:30am-10:30am Keynote Address
Ken Olden, PhD, ScD, LHD *
Dean, CUNY School of Public Health
Former Director, National Institute of Environmental Health
Science (NIEHS)
10:30am – 11:00am Break
11:00am – 12:00pm Panel: Through the Lens: Strategies and Success Stories in Reducing Health Disparities
Moderator: Humberto Brown, MS
Panelists:
Jane Bedell, MD *
Assistant Commissioner
Bronx District Office of Public Health
Lucretia Jones, MPH*
Board Member
Mothers on the Move
Joann Casado *
Executive Director
The Bronx Health Link
Rev. Rosa Carballo*
Founder
Bruised Reed Ministry
Ken Olden, PhD, ScD, LHD *
Dean, CUNY School of Public Health
12:00pm – 1:00pm Lunch
Camara Jones, MD, MPH, PhD*
Research Director
Social Determinants of Health and Equity
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C)
1:00pm – 3:30pm Concurrent Workshops
*Note: Please Select an Option for Each Session
1:00pm - 2:15pm Session A
2:15pm-3:30pm Session B
I. Live Well, Live Long: Promoting Healthy Life Choices
II. Partnership in Action: Improving the Physical and Social Environments
III. Addressing the Social and Economic Determinants of Health: The Burden of Poverty, Housing, and Hunger
IV. Community Health: Promoting Policy, Systems, and Environmental Changes in Your Neighborhoods
V. Achieving Health Care Reform: The Impact of Race, Culture, and Ethnicity
3:30pm – 4:00pm Workshop Summary
4:00 pm - 4:30pm Closing Remarks
Evaluations

Bronx Center to Reduce and Eliminate Ethnic and Racial Health Disparities (Bronx CREED)/Albert Einstien College of Medicine
Mission
To reduce and eliminate ethnic and racial health disparities in the Bronx, New York City, and the nation through:
- Promotion, coordination, and integration of health disparities research at the College of Medicine.
- Community outreach, information dissemination, and collaboration.
- Health disparities education for health professionals, community members, policymakers and public officials.
- Training of investigators at the undergraduate, graduate and post-doctoral levels.
- Strengthening and expanding existing academic-community partnerships in the Bronx.
Our initial focus will be in primary, secondary and tertiary prevention and treatment of the cluster of conditions associated with the greatest source of excess morbidity and mortality among African-Americans and Latinos in the Bronx and the nation, that is heart disease, stroke, and diabetes.
